One of avant-pop's great musical minds, Brazilian eccentric Tom Ze is shamefully underrepresented on American record shelves (his only two U.S. releases are out of print). This new album, Fabrication Defect, isn't as good a starting place as 1990's Best of, but Ze fans craving more music won't be disappointed, even if it is both less traditional and less overtly avant-garde than his past work.
